Use Cases and Applications

Ethereum and Bitcoin serve different purposes within the cryptocurrency ecosystem. Bitcoin is often considered a store of value, while Ethereum is known for its decentralized applications (DApps) and smart contracts. If you’re looking to diversify your portfolio, understanding the use cases of each cryptocurrency can help you make an informed decision.
